WebOf the molecular imaging techniques in use today, nuclear medicine procedures, such as PET scans and I-131 radiotherapy, use small amounts of radioactive materials, called radiopharmaceuticals or radiotracers, to diagnose and treat disease. In general, the radiation risk involved in these procedures is very low compared with the potential benefits.
